Explore a 39-minute conference talk on strong convergence for tensor GUE random matrices presented by Wangjun Yuan at the Centre International de Rencontres Mathématiques in Marseille, France. Recorded during the thematic meeting "Random quantum channels: entanglement and entropies" on July 8, 2024, this presentation delves into advanced mathematical concepts.
